The size of Moonee Ponds is approximately 4.4 square kilometres. It has 20 parks covering nearly 17.0% of total area. The population of Moonee Ponds in 2016 was 14250 people. By 2021 the population was 16224 showing a population growth of 13.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Moonee Ponds is 30-39 years. Households in Moonee Ponds are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Moonee Ponds work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 58.90% of the homes in Moonee Ponds were owner-occupied compared with 60.30% in 2016.
